Output 8978663fb0b6d3aed6e191d24e0d4b99650ce9877a228d19d7e696dcc8bcfb8e:1

value
3799900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cabfdf5caa6c6ae2ecd0f087e16a4f43b8c9fe0 OP_EQUAL
address
3EWpZcg4yezWNF4chgxA3FjoijgWeNsKy4
transaction
8978663fb0b6d3aed6e191d24e0d4b99650ce9877a228d19d7e696dcc8bcfb8e
confirmations
166934
spent
true